Hello All, I started working in 2014 and worked for that company until 2018 (Company 1). In 2018, I joined another company and am currently working there (Company 2).

At Company 1, I completed all necessary documentation after my departure, including the release letter, experience letter (provided after 4 months of departure), and full and final settlement (issued after 4 months of departure). All documents were provided with positive reviews.

However, in 2024, after almost 6 years, when I attempted to transition to Company 2 and apply to an MNC, Company 1 provided negative reviews during the MNC's background verification process. They claimed that I shared the company's private data to secure a position at a competitor company, thus violating their policies. These allegations are entirely false. Company 1 is attributing this to the high turnover rate, as most employees left within 2 years.

What steps can I take in this situation?

Steps to Address False Negative Review from Previous Company

🔍 Investigate the Allegations:
- Request specific details from the MNC about the negative feedback provided by Company 1. Understand the nature of the allegations and gather evidence to refute them.

📝 Gather Evidence:
- Collect any documentation, emails, or communication that can support your case and prove that the allegations are false. This may include your employment records, performance appraisals, and any relevant correspondence.

📞 Contact Company 1:
- Reach out to the HR department or a senior official at Company 1 to discuss the situation. Provide your evidence and seek clarification on why they provided negative feedback during the background verification process.

📄 Legal Consultation:
- If the issue persists and affects your career prospects, consider seeking legal advice to understand your rights and options under Indian labor laws regarding defamation or false accusations.

🤝 Mediation:
- Explore the possibility of mediation between you, Company 1, and the MNC to resolve the misunderstanding and clear your reputation. A neutral third party can facilitate constructive dialogue.

📃 Request Correction:
- Politely request Company 1 to rectify the negative feedback provided to the MNC and issue a revised statement that accurately reflects your tenure and conduct during your employment.

🔗 Maintain Professionalism:
- Throughout the process, maintain a professional demeanor and focus on resolving the issue amicably. Avoid confrontational or aggressive behavior that could escalate the situation.

📌 Document Everything:
- Keep a record of all communications, meetings, and actions taken to address the false negative review. This documentation may be valuable if further steps are necessary.

🔍 Follow Up:
- Regularly follow up with both Company 1 and the MNC to track the progress of resolving the issue. Persistence and proactive communication can help expedite the resolution process.

Taking proactive steps to address the false negative review from Company 1 can help safeguard your professional reputation and ensure fair treatment during background verification processes.
